Output 7ef75367e27ec4e44f03d5023e878157d2177afb504f768daebdb1e009f4621d:6

value
25582647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c981ecd1597dbd859800b38bf2f8f01dc0121b59 OP_EQUAL
address
MSGdhLgdzqTnfeJwT9KHX2v5XPj4WEcKua
transaction
7ef75367e27ec4e44f03d5023e878157d2177afb504f768daebdb1e009f4621d
spent
true